CNC operator's panel gives machine
design freedom
A new, easy-to-customise, machine tool operator's panel, suitable for use with Fanuc Series 16i, 18i and 21i CNC systems, has been developed by GE Fanuc.

Until now, any machine tool builder requiring a bespoke panel, had to request GE Fanuc to develop a customised key sheet and possibly incurred a time delay in receiving it.
Now the machine tool builder can customise its own keys and produce an original key layout in-house.
Two types of unit are available: an integrated type incorporated into the full alphabet key Machine Data Interface (MDI) and a stand-alone type.
The new pads can be laid out in either horizontal format or vertical format to suit the overall panel design and different matching versions of separate panels for mechanical switches, such as an emergency stop switch, can be added.
Sufficient interface for a pendant box is provided and incorporates the following features: * 55 operation keys plus LEDs for status display.
* General purpose DI: 32 points for rotary and other switches.
* General purpose DO: eight points.
* Manual pulse generator interface: three units.
The machine operator's panel is easy to customise because all key tops are detachable.
By using the pre-marked key tops any desired layout can be arranged and the additionally supplied blank key tops can be marked with any special inscription peculiar to the customer's own application.
Transparent key tops can be overlaid to provide protection to the markings on the key labels themselves.
